Aircraft that goes by means of solar energy





Solar Impulse, the first aircraft that operates entirely on solar energy, successfully performed a 18-hour trip from California to Arizona.
Phoenix was the first leg of the flight, which will lead plane, run by a Swiss pilot, across the United States without using fuel, but only energy from sunlight.

"It took a lot of preparation and an enormous commitment on the first flight. We have time to work on this thing and I do not believe that the first part ended, "said Bertrand Piccard, pilot.

Piccard adventurer touched down about midnight, and this is another of the Solar Impulse particular, the fact that using solar energy can fly as day and night
   Flight from Northern California was conducted at an average speed of 49 kilometers per hour. Piccard and copilot, Andre Borshberg plan to divide tasks making long stops in Phoenix, Dallas, St. Louis and Washington, before the final landing in New York next month.

The aircraft in question has wings of a 747 passenger plane, but the weight of an average car. He collects the sun's energy and stores in a battery, which enables even during night flights.

  But the greatest speed he can reach, since only 70 miles per hour, makes the necessary stops.
